The Benefits of Cloud Computing
In the environment of commercial enterprise software programs, the readily available software have typically been pretty involved and overpriced. They require a corporation in Kern to invest deeply on capital expenditure to establish an in-house data center with offices, environmental controls, electrical power, dedicated servers, storage disks, and network capacity. In addition to all this costly computing equipment is the requirement for a complicated software stack for the application. Even after the software has been written, you will also must have a group of professionals to set up, configure, and run the software. But that was before the development of cloud computing.
A simple example of cloud computing is email provided without software set up from suppliers such as Microsoft's Hotmail or Google's Gmail. You don't need to install any software or purchase a dedicated server in order to utilize them. All an organization needs is simply an internet connection so the clients can begin sending emails. The server and email management software is entirely on the cloud and is totally managed by the cloud service provider such as Microsoft, Yahoo, or Google. The user will get the use of the software and enjoy the advantages.
Companies in Kern are operating a load of applications in the cloud these days, such as customer service management, HR, accounting, and other custom programs. Cloud-based software can be functioning in a day or two, which is unheard of with typical business applications. They are less expensive, due to the fact you don't have to pay for all the workers, solutions, and data centers to run them. And, it seems they're more expandable, more secure, and more reliable than most software. Also, advancements are taken care of for you, so your apps get protection and performance enhancements and new features automagically.
